Serrate perforated 4 r. on rose, together with 2nd printing serrate perforated 2 r. on green and 3rd printing, oblong quadrille paper, serrate perforated 1 r. on blue, used together on entire letter to Zamora, forwarded from Colima and tied by oval "CORREOS GUADALAJARA". Few short perfs and some minor staining, otherwise very fine (arrival mark on reverse little improved by pencil). All three stamps are rare, just one further cover has been recorded with the 4 r. A unique three colour franking with serrated stamps and without doubt the most important cover of the Guadalajara provisional issues. Certificate MEPSI (1999)
